Week 16: Sharing the Planet: How do we affect other living things? 

The planet earth is in our hands. People are not the only living things that live on earth. We share the planet with other living things such as plants and animals. 

How do we affect other living things? People change the earth around them. They cut down trees. They build homes, roads, and factories. All of these changes hurt the animals and plants that live in that place.

Ending the term with great knowledge as we talked about how people affect other living things. The students learned that we all share the planet and we are responsible for our planet earth.
